HTML 5 與 CSS 角度
HTML 5 與 CSS 角度是現代 Web 開發中的重要組成部分。HTML 5 定義了用于構建 Web 內容的標準、語法和語義元素,CSS 則用于為這些內容提供樣式和布局。
HTML 5 新增的語義元素使得 Web 內容更加清晰易懂。例如,使用 header 元素表示頁面頂部的標題欄,使用 nav 元素表示頁面導航菜單,使用 main 元素表示頁面主要內容,使用 footer 元素表示頁面底部信息等等。這些語義元素有助于提高搜索引擎優化和 Web 內容可訪問性。
HTML 5 中的表單元素也得到了很大的改善。新的 input 類型和屬性允許我們輕松地創建日期選擇器、搜索框、電話號碼和電子郵件輸入框等等。此外,HTML 5 還支持自定義表單驗證和提交方式,使得表單處理更加簡單靈活。
CSS 利用選擇器和規則集控制 HTML 內容的樣式和布局。CSS 3 提供了許多新的選擇器和屬性,如 :nth-child()、@media、box-sizing 和 border-radius 等等。這些新特性使得 Web 開發更加高效和直觀。
CSS 還支持動畫和過渡效果,比如使用 transition 屬性創建平滑的鼠標懸停效果,使用 animation 屬性創建復雜的動畫序列。這些特性允許我們創建更加生動和精美的 Web 內容。
在實踐中,HTML 5 和 CSS 是密切相連的。HTML 元素和 CSS 樣式表必須協同工作才能實現最佳效果。例如,我們可以使用 HTML 5 的語義元素和屬性來構建頁面結構和內容,然后使用 CSS 來為其提供樣式和布局。這種分離樣式和內容的方法促進了 Web 內容的重用性和可維護性。
綜上所述,HTML 5 和 CSS 是現代 Web 開發不可或缺的組成部分。它們的新特性和語法為 Web 內容提供了更高的表現力、更高的效率和更高的可訪問性。在 HTML 5 和 CSS 的指導下,我們可以創造出更加出色的 Web 體驗。
網站導航
- zblogPHP模板zbpkf
- zblog免費模板zblogfree
- zblog模板學習zblogxuexi
- zblogPHP仿站zbpfang